Kompany Rejects World Cup Pundit Role

FC Bayern Munich manager Vincent Kompany has turned down multiple offers to work as a television pundit during the upcoming World Cup, insisting he would rather use the period to rest and spend time with his family.

Interest in the Belgian coach reportedly came from several English broadcasters ahead of the tournament set to be hosted across the United States, Canada and Mexico. However, Kompany made it clear he had no intention of taking up the role.

“No chance, no chance,” he said, cutting in before a question referencing the report was even completed.

“What am I supposed to do, work as a TV pundit on holiday? I won’t have a family left in Munich next year,” said the coach while he appeared in a press conference ahead of Wednesday’s cup semi-final against Bayer Leverkusen.

He doubled down on the stance in a lighter tone, adding: “Why should I work as a TV pundit while I’m on holiday? Then I won’t have a family left in Munich next year,” a remark that drew laughter during the press conference.

According to reports by journalist Mike and Keegan, the interest from English media was largely driven by Kompany’s insight into England striker Harry Kane, whom he manages at Bayern. Despite his previous punditry roles with major networks, the former defender has opted against combining work with his break after a demanding campaign.

Fresh from securing their 35th Bundesliga title, Bayern now shift focus to the DFB-Pokal, where they face Bayer Leverkusen in a crucial semi-final. Victory would send the German giants into their first final since 2020.

Kompany, however, must navigate the fixture without key players Serge Gnabry, Lennart Karl and Tom Bischof, all sidelined through injury.

Attention is now on Jamal Musiala, who is working his way back to peak condition after a lengthy spell out. Kompany expressed optimism about the midfielder’s progress, noting that he is “in good form” and “very close to his best level.”

Looking ahead, Bayern also have their sights set on a heavyweight UEFA Champions League semi-final class against Paris Saint-Germain, scheduled for April 28 and May 6. With Gnabry unavailable, Musiala is expected to play a central role once again, having already made a decisive impact in the quarter-final against Real Madrid.

In that tie, the young star changed the game as a substitute, drawing a booking from Eduardo Camavinga with a dazzling run before setting up a late equaliser that helped Bayern seal progression.
